Originally Posted by h2ocowboy
How was the ride?

It was probably the toughest 1 day challenge of my life and I wouldn't change a thing...except try to go faster. I had perfect weather and followed my plan of stops for water and food. I had to stop way more than I thought I would to rest. The altitude was rough being that I'm at pretty much sea level in Seattle. I think it was around 6 hours and 45 minutes moving time up and 43 flat from summit to the car. Going down was much, much easier!
